A Phase IIb, Open Label, Randomized Controlled Dose Ranging Multi-Center Trial to Evaluate the Safety, Tolerability, Pharmacokinetics and Exposure-Response Relationship of Different Doses of Delpazolid in Combination With Bedaquiline Delamanid Moxifloxacin in Adult Subjects With Newly Diagnosed, Uncomplicated, Smear-Positive, Drug-sensitive Pulmonary Tuberculosis

A Phase 2 clinical trial evaluating Delpazolid and Bedaquiline, Delamanid, Moxifloxacin for Infections and Infestations and Pulmonary Tuberculosis. Completed, enrolled 76 participants across 5 sites in 2 countries.

This trial is to describe the safety, tolerability and exposure-toxicity relationship of Depazolid given over 16 weeks, in combination with standard-dose Bedaquiline, Delamanid and Moxifloxacin, compared to standard-dose Bedaquiline, Delamanid and Moxifloxacin alone

Interventions
Delpazolid is not licensed yet. Current experience in humans upto Phase IIA. Dose according to randomization to dosing arms 2-5.
These three licensed drugs form the backbone of a new regimen to which delpazolid is added in arms 2-5.
